Summary Pericardial effusion represents the accumulation of larger amounts of fluid in the pericardial cavity. If not timely diagnosed and adequately treated, it can lead to cardiac tamponade. The treatment of pericardial effusion includes primarily the use of drugs like aspirin, NSAIDs, corticosteroids, and/or colchicine followed by invasive procedures such as pericardiocentesis or pericardiectomy. Pericardiocentesis complications are extremely rare but very serious especially in the case of the rupture of the right ventricle or the coronary arteries. Patient S.V, born in 1938, from Svrljig, was examined because of suffocating and swollen shin. The medical reports showed that the patient previously had had a permanent pacemaker implanted and that he had undergone a triple coronary artery bridging. Medical reports also showed that two months before the examination he was hospitalized due to pericardial effusion at the reference institution. The ultrasonographic examination registered large circular effusion with the motion of the right ventricle and the patient underwent urgent pericardiocentesis. During pericardiocentesis, the rupture of the right ventricle occurred and the patient was sent to the cardiac surgery clinic where he had catheter extraction performed. The control ultrasound examination of the heart showed no pericardial effusion, and no signs of damage to the right ventricle.

Abstract Ventricular shunting is a well-recognised and commonly practiced method of reducing increased intracranial pressure in patients with neurologic pathology. There are possible complications related to shunt implantation, where the rarest is intracardiac migration of the distal shunt catheter. We present a case where the distal catheter migrated into the right ventricle, causing extrasystoles and was complicated with acute right ventricle failure during the endovascular shunt evacuation procedure.

Cardiac echinococcus is a rare affliction of the heart caused by the tapeworm Echinococcus granulosus. Primary echinococcosis of the heart represents 0.5–2% of all hydatid disease cases in endemic regions. It evolves slowly, explaining its rarity in children. We report the case of a 11-year-old child affected by a giant cardiac cyst of the left ventricle (LV). The patient underwent cardiac surgery and medical treatment. A retrospective review of the current literature was realized. We found 18 cases: the mean age was 11-years old. Nine cysts were localized in the LV, four in the interventricular septum, three in the right ventricle, and two in the right atrium. All underwent surgery except six patients. Routine echocardiographic screening may be useful in endemic regions where infestation is common. Cardiac echinococcus should be diagnosed in the early and uncomplicated stages and be removed surgically even in asymptomatic patients.

Abstract Introduction Needle embolism is a rare complication of intravenous drug abuse which has only been reported on a handful of occasions. Potential sequelae include cardiac perforation, tamponade, infective endocarditis and recurrent pericarditis. We report the case of a young intravenous opiate abuser. Case Report A 23-year-old heroin addicted man presented to the emergency department because of chest pain ensued six months before; the pain was sharp, was relieved by sitting up and leaning forward and increased with coughing, swallowing, deep breathing or lying flat. He complained also fatigue and fever since one month before presentation. Echocardiography revealed non haemodinamic pericardial effusion and pleural effusion, treated with pleural drainage. Three haemocoltures were negative. Cardiac biomarkers were negative. HIV, HBV and HCV sierology was negative. He was treated with cochicine and ibuprofen and empiric antibiotic therapy with initial improvement of symptoms and rapid recurrence of them. After a few weeks an ECG showed widespread concave ST segment elevation and an echocardiogram revealed pericardial effusion relapse. A chest radiograph showed a needle near the right ventricle. The patient underwent computed tomography angiography that was able to localize a needle inside the pericardium. A second echocardiogram confirmed the presence of the fragment in the pericardial cavity, beside the right ventricle. The patient underwent minithoracototomy surgical removal of the needle fragment and of 500 cc of haematic pericardial fluid. Discussion and conclusions The presence of a foreign body in the heart may result from either a direct injury to the heart such as a gunshot injury or from some other embolization to the heart from distal penetration sites (eg, the migration of a catheter or a needle fragment from a peripheral vessel). It may cause fever, recurrent pericarditis and arrhythmia. Surgical extraction in the therapy of choice. Abstract P842 Figure.

Purpose: Pericardial effusion in patients who have recently undergone cardiac surgery is often trapped in compartments. CT of the pericardium provides good information about the distribution of pericardial fluid in the postoperative period after cardiac surgery. Contrary to echocardiography, CT imaging is not affected by postoperative mediastinal emphysema and pain from the wound. A method for CT-guided pericardiocentesis was developed. Material and Methods: CT-guided pericardiocentesis was carried out with a stereotactic device in 10 patients. The pericardium was punctured with a 0.9-mm needle and a 0.46-mm guide wire was introduced through the needle. An indwelling catheter was introduced over the guide wire and was left in the pericardium. Both the subxiphoid and parasternal approaches were used. Results: CT guidance facilitated placement of an indwelling catheter into the pericardial space in positions difficult to reach in patients with postoperative pericardial compartments, i.e. near the right atrium and adjacent to the cardiac apex/left ventricle. Conclusion: CT-guided pericardiocentesis offers a new possibility in patients where fluoroscopically or echocardiographically guided pericardiocentesis is difficult.

ABSTRACT CONTEXT: Obstruction of the right ventricular outflow tract due to metastatic disease is rare. Clinical recognition of cardiac metastatic tumors is rare and continues to present a diagnostic and therapeutic challenge. CASE REPORT: We present the case of a patient who had severe respiratory insufficiency and whose clinical examinations revealed a giant tumor mass extending from the right ventricle to the pulmonary artery. We discuss the diagnostic and therapeutic options. CONCLUSION: In patients presenting with acute right heart failure, right ventricular masses should be kept in mind. Transthoracic echocardiography appears to be the most easily available, noninvasive, cost-effective and useful technique in making the differential diagnosis.
